MSAA 2017 Year in Review

As we approach the end of 2017, let’s take a moment to look at some of the many accomplishments achieved during the year.

First, 2017 was a GOOD YEAR for MSAA, SIAA, and our members. In fact, in terms of profit sharing, growth bonuses, and PMSF from SIAA, 2017 is shaping up to be our best year ever!

We have achieved growth with almost all our strategic partner carriers, and excellent growth with carriers such as Travelers, Liberty, Hartford Commercial, and State Auto. Congratulations!

In a year where the carriers’ results were hit by several hurricanes, massive wildfires, and floods, MSAA weathered (pun intended) the year with no major CAT losses. This resulted in us being profitable across the board with all the carriers we represent (as of November results). And we are locked in with many carriers – Including Safeco at 45%. Congratulations again!

This year brought a major platform change to the SIAA NetWeb system. We were able to navigate these changes relatively seamlessly, with little or no disruption in our day to day operations.

MSAA continued to offer training on all lines of business, averaging over 10 webinars per month along with other training opportunities from the carriers and within SIAA’s Training and Learning Center. Thank you, Kristin for coordinating the training!

Speaking of the TLC keep in mind that it continues to grow as SIAA adds more and more courses. A reminder: TLC is now available to you as a member for no cost. Free is a good price! This includes all the Continuing Education Credits available in the TLC where you only have to pay the filing fee.

Also at the national level, SIAA has finalized our 2018 PMSF agreements, so members will continue to receive quarterly payments from our Strategic Partnership Carriers. SIAA is now well over $6 Billion in aggregated premium!

SIAA’s exclusive training program Business Insurance Advantage also has been revamped. The next class beginning in January will be eight weeks, with monthly follow-up calls. BIA students have enjoyed an approximate 23% increase in small commercial business compared with prior years. BIA also generates cross sales to other lines, including personal lines and life.
